The University of Bristol Dental School is a school that is part of the Faculty of Health Sciences at the University of Bristol. The school also has a hospital of its own.
In the QS World University Rankings 2022, the University of Bristol is placed 62nd in the world, making it one of the most popular and successful institutions in the UK. It was also ranked 10th by QS World University Rankings in the UK. It was established in 1909 but its earliest history can be traced back to 1595 when the engineering department of the Merchant Venturers' Technical College was founded. The university was formerly known as the University College, Bristol that was established in 1876.
The University of Bristol Dental School offers undergraduate and postgraduate programmes. Undergraduate programmes include The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) degree. It equips you with a solid foundation of the basic set of skills needed in today's clinical dental practice. As for postgraduate programmes, they include DDS Orthodontics Doctorate in Dental Surgery, MSc Dental Implantology, Postgraduate Certificate Clinical Conscious Sedation and Anxiety Management…etc.
Since the school is a part of the University of Bristol, students of the Dental School are allowed access to the facilities and services at the university. The School has a dental hospital where dental students get more training and practice. It also has many research facilities and clinics. The University has nine libraries which include the Arts and Social Sciences Library, Chemistry Library, Medical Library…etc. It also has plenty of comfortable study spaces for students which include the Beacon House Study Centre, Brambles Study Centre, and Grace Reeves Study Centre. The university also provides students with an IT Service Desk that offers dedicated laptop and mobile clinics. It furthermore has many laboratories that are equipped with the latest state-of-the-art facilities. Sports and health amenities are provided at the school; they include an indoor sports centre, a swimming pool, and a sports medicine clinic.
There’s a University of Bristol Dental School student accommodation. The university offers students three residential villages: North Residential Village, East Residential Village, and West Residential Village. Each residential village has many buildings which include Manor Hall, The Hawthorns, University Hall…etc. There are many types of rooms with different grades available; they include single rooms, ensuite rooms, twin rooms, studio rooms…etc. Accessible rooms are also available. The residences offer 24/7 support, security and CCTV, a junior common room, a bus pass, and student parking.
